"The Janesville Daily Gazette", Janesville, Wisconsin, Monday, Jan. 24, 2005, p 2B.

Janesville - Elaine S. Starks, age 78, a lifelong Janesville resident, passed away early Sunday morning, Jan. 23, 2005 at Alden Meadow Park Health Center, Clinton, WI. She was born April 29, 1926 in Janesville, the daughter of the late Harlowe and Hilda (Ambrose) Clarke. On May 28, 1944 she married George A. Starks in Janesville; he preceded her in death on Feb. 6, 2004. Elaine was a home maker whose life centered around her family. She enjoyed cooking and entertaining her family. She very much enjoyed camping and fishing with George, and always loved taking walks and enjoying the outdoors. Her other interest was reading, especially western novels and stories.

She is survived by her five daughters: Georgene Wienke, Connie (Jim) Thompson, Carol (Tom) West, Shirley (fiancé David Zirbel) Neumueller, and Karen (fiancé Donald McCoic) Stricklin, all of Janesville; her 2 brothers, Harlowe (Marcy) Clarke of California and Duane (Janice) Clarke of Adams Friendship, WI; her 3 sisters: Marjorie (Glen) Howard of Janesville, Margaret (Lloyd) Wincapaw of Fayetteville, OK, and Hilda (Don) Kramer of California; 11 grandchildren; 17 great-grandchildren; and many nieces, nephews, and friends. Besides her husband and parents, she was preceded in death by 2 sisters, Lucille Clarke and Anna Schiefelbein; a brother, Paul Clarke; and by her son-in-law, Ron Wienke.

Funeral services will be held at 2 p.m. Thursday, Jan. 27, 2005 at the Milton Lawns Memorial Chapel, with Rev. David Javan officiating. Entombment will follow in Milton Lawns Memorial Park Mausoleum. Friends may call on Thursday from 1 until 2 p.m. at the chapel. In lieu of other expressions of sympathy, memorials in Elaine's name may be made to her family. Elaine's family would like to extend their deepest appreciation to the staff at Alden Meadow Park Health Center, and to the wonderful staff at HospiceCare, Inc. for all their love and care for Elaine. The Whitcomb-Lynch-Albrecht Funeral Home, Janesville, is assisting her family with arrangements.
